@Logins 

That imo indicates a repeating command reducing Beams vomume until it mutes (green led). 
Please check your AppleTVs remote settings in tvOS settings and also your tvs hdmi cec communication settings. 
You should avoid using remote simultaneously via infrared and hdmi cec. 
I suggest to try via hdmi cec and if that doesn’t work to try infrared. Using AppleTV remote usually you don’t have to run the ir remote pairing via Sonos app as atv remote is recognized automatically.

How long after you attempt to raise the Volume does the Volume go down? Do you have a similar response when attempting to lower the Volume?

If the Volume reverts to the previous value, I suspect a communication issue between controller and BEAM 2. As you drag the Volume bar, the bar will respond in real time while attempting to send commands to the player. A second or two later the controller will interrogate the player and update the display to show the player’s current Volume. If one or more original Volume commands were missed, the display will report the current Volume — which may not be what you expect. I also suspect that there is a minimum dwell time as you drag the control before anything is transmitted to the player. You can test this postulation by dwelling slightly longer at the new setting before removing your finger.

Are you more successful if you touch the slider track rather than dragging the dot?

You can submit a diagnostic and follow up with Support. Communication issues, if any, will leave tracks in the diagnostics.

I suppose the ATV remote could have been paired manually within Sonos app and the wrong (reverse) volume button could have been used for pairing. 
If so, try pairing it again or deactivate IR usage for Beam within Sonos app settings and just try hdmi cec control.
